went to the range today with the .270 and 30-30 and it was a 15yd range. the guy said if i aimed at the bullseye and i hit an inch low that at 200yds that it would be perfect. is this true?
That sounds pretty close, at least for the .270. For a 100 yard shot, the bullet crosses the sight line the first time at around 25 yards- usually if you are on at 25 you will be very close at 100. Zeroing at 50 yards will put you 3-4" high at 100, and right about on at 200, same should work for 15 yards with it being a little low at 200.

The 30-30 will be much further off at 200- after 150 yards, the bullet drops very fast.

You need to be dead nuts on at a shorter range though, a 1/2 inch off at 15 yards will put you at least 7" off at 200. You will also need to verify your zero at the range you will shoot it at if you have any hope of cleanly harvesting game with it.
